Michael Jackson Biopic “Michael” Set for 2026 Release Amidst Controversy

The highly anticipated biopic chronicling the life of Michael Jackson, titled “Michael,” is now slated for release in the spring of 2026, according to recent reports. The film, which has faced scrutiny and debate since its inception, promises a deep dive into the complex life and enduring legacy of the “King of Pop.”

The Long Road to the Big Screen

For years, a Michael Jackson biopic has been a project fraught with challenges. Concerns surrounding the portrayal of allegations against Jackson have been central to the debate, prompting discussions about how to responsibly depict a figure whose artistry was undeniable but whose personal life was shadowed by controversy. Initial plans faced hurdles, and the project underwent significant revisions before finding its current footing.

The film’s production has been closely watched by fans and critics alike. Jaafar Jackson, Michael’s nephew, has taken on the monumental task of portraying his uncle, a casting choice that has generated both excitement and apprehension. Early images released from the set, as reported by RTL.fr, offer a glimpse into the film’s visual style and Jaafar Jackson’s physical resemblance to his uncle. A recently unveiled trailer, highlighted by The Parisian, has further fueled anticipation, showcasing key moments from Jackson’s life and career.

The biopic aims to explore Jackson’s creative process, his struggles with fame, and the complexities of his personal relationships. It will undoubtedly address the controversies that plagued his later years, but the extent to which these issues will be explored remains a subject of speculation. allocine.fr provides a detailed look at the initial reactions to the released footage.

The delay to a spring 2026 release, as reported by 7sur7.be, suggests the filmmakers are taking the time to ensure a sensitive and comprehensive portrayal of Jackson’s life. The additional time allows for meticulous editing and refinement, potentially addressing concerns raised by critics and fans.
